What We Do

The CFO seat, without the headcount.

OpsFlow Finance plugs CFO-level finance into businesses that need the thinking but aren’t ready to hire it full time. Owners get the same diligence, working-capital discipline, and decision-grade analysis that a $250K full-time CFO would bring — sized to the business, scoped to the engagement.

01 · Fractional CFO

Ongoing financial leadership

Monthly retainer engagements for owners who need a steady financial hand. Cadenced reporting, KPI dashboards, lender and board prep.

02 · Exit Readiness

Audit before you go to market

The 79-item diligence audit PE buyers actually run, applied to your business 12–24 months before you list. Fix what's broken before a buyer finds it.

03 · Project CFO

Defined engagements with a deliverable

Lending close, ERP selection, acquisition diligence, financial model build. Scoped, time-boxed, fixed-fee.

04 · Cohort Program

For owners learning the language

A ten-week peer cohort for owners who want to read their financials like a CFO would. Ten owners per cohort, one per industry.
